Key legal question
Whether the complaint had to be entered into despite non-payment of the court advance.
Extracted holding
No. After the advance was set, a non-extendable grace period expired without payment, so the Court did not enter into the complaint.
Extracted reasoning
Under Art. 62 BGG, the party bringing the case must pay an advance on costs. If the advance is not paid within the set period and grace period, the Federal Supreme Court may not proceed to the merits; here no valid reason excused the failure, especially after legal aid was refused for lack of proof of indigence.
